Since home field advantage counted in the post-merger playoffs, 24 of the NFC’s top seeds have reached the Super Bowl. The 2016 New England Patriots are just the 23rd top seeded AFC team to reach the Super Bowl but only eight were crowned world champions.

In the opening wild-card round, the 2-seed hosts the 7-seed, the 3-seed hosts the 6-seed and the 4-seed hosts the 5-seed.
